#include "ya_st.h"
#include <QtGui>
#include <QApplication>
#define YASST_VERSION "20090420"
long yasst_rand();
#include "backend/BirdBox.h"
#include "backend/ImageCache.h"
#include "yasstFns.h"
#include "YasstApplication.h"
int main(int argc, char *argv[])
{
srand(QDateTime::currentDateTime().toTime_t()); // Yes, I know. But actual randomness isn't important, it's used as jitter.
QCoreApplication::setApplicationName("Yasst");
QCoreApplication::setOrganizationName("yasst.org");
QCoreApplication::setOrganizationDomain("yasst.org");
//BirdBox b;
ImageCache c;
YasstApplication a(argc, argv);
QApplication::setQuitOnLastWindowClosed(false);
Ya_st w(&c);
QStringList args = QCoreApplication::arguments();
QString tweet="";
QString tweetAs="";
for (int x=0,state=0;x<args.count();x++) {
QString arg=args.at(x).toLower();
if (state==0) {
if (arg=="-tweet") {
state=1;
} else if (arg=="-tweetas") {
state=2;
}
} else if (state==1) {
tweet=arg;
state=0;
} else if (state==2) {
tweetAs=arg;
state=0;
}
}
if (tweet!="" && tweetAs!="") {
w.tweetAndQuit(tweet,tweetAs);
} else
w.show();
return a.exec();
}
